Expert Match Analysis

The quarter-final of the Albanian Cup brings together two sides trending in opposite directions. Vllaznia Shkoder currently leads the Kategoria Superiore standings, serving as the benchmark for consistency in Albanian football this season.

Their home form at the Stadiumi Loro Boriçi has been nothing short of imperious; they have secured 12 wins from 14 home matches in the league and remain unbeaten in their last 10 cup fixtures on home turf.

Offensively, Vllaznia is the most potent side in the country, having netted 36 goals while maintaining a disciplined defensive shape that has seen them win 10 of their last 11 matches across all competitions.

Bylis Ballsh, on the other hand, is embroiled in a relegation scrap, currently sitting in 8th place. While they did manage a surprising 2-1 victory over Vllaznia in their most recent league encounter in late February, their away record tells a different story.

Bylis has struggled to find the net consistently on the road, averaging less than a goal per game. Statistical trends favor a low-scoring affair, as several of their recent H2H meetings have seen under 2.5 goals.

However, the psychological weight of this being a second-leg cup tie means Vllaznia will likely push for an early goal to erase any aggregate concerns. With Vllaznia’s current momentum and their stellar home record, the tactical battle should see the hosts controlling the midfield and testing a Bylis defense that has conceded 36 goals this season.
